Victorian Silver Cruet and Mustard
19th century, cruet stand appears unmarked (acid tested silver), with chased floral designs between beaded borders, raised on foliate scrolled feet and center stem with ring finial, holding three cut crystal bottles, the salt and mustard with silver lids. Salt, with worn mark of Henry Manton?, Birmingham, 1858 date mark (7 3/4 in.); the mustard with chased floral and stippled garland motifs, hinged lid with acorn finial, fixed glass lined interior, appears unmarked (acid tested silver).
5.80 total weighable troy oz.
From the Collection of the late Zirkle James Estes, Jr., Charlottesville, Virginia

Condition
Silver salt lid with denting and wear to finial; crack and loss vinegar rim with associated glued repair, chip to fitted interior end of vinegar stopper.
